International Personal Liability Insurance While Traveling

Before you leave for your next trip, one crucial consideration may be insurance that covers international personal liability. The benefit of personal liability is paid to cover expenses due to injury to a 3rd person or damage to that person’s property. For example, should you get into an accident where you are at fault for the above, the costs associated with that accident will be covered according to the policy terms and conditions.

Finding a travel medical policy that includes personal liability coverage is challenging. It presents an additional layer of risk for the underwriters and is difficult to determine, making it challenging to assign a price.

What is Personal Liability Insurance

Liability insurance protects you if you are held responsible for injuring someone else or damaging their property. Instead of paying benefits to you, it pays the person who experienced the loss. It also includes legal defense if a claim is filed against you, and in many cases, the cost of defending you does not reduce your coverage limits.

Personal liability coverage is the portion of your insurance that protects you when accidents happen. It helps pay for:

  • Medical bills if you unintentionally injure someone
  • Repairs or replacement if you damage another person’s property
  • Legal costs if you are accused of causing an accident

This coverage does not protect your own injuries or personal belongings. It only applies to harm or damage you unintentionally cause to others.

Liability Coverage When Renting Property Abroad

If you are renting a property while abroad, the landlord may require proof of liability coverage in case you accidentally cause damage during your stay. The Atlas Travel insurance plan includes up to $25,000 in personal liability protection, with the option to increase coverage to $100,000. This benefit can help cover eligible court-ordered judgments or approved settlements related to accidental damage or loss of a third party’s personal property.
